The cheapest way to get from Rome to Isfahan is to fly which costs $140 - $650 and takes 11h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Rome to Isfahan is to fly which takes 11h 55m and costs $140 - $650.
The distance between Rome and Isfahan is 3638 km. The road distance is 4889.5 km.
It takes approximately 11h 55m to get from Rome to Isfahan, including transfers.
Isfahan is 1h 30m ahead of Rome. It is currently 11:36 AM in Rome and 1:06 PM in Isfahan.
Yes, the driving distance between Rome to Isfahan is 4889 km. It takes approximately 2 days 4h to drive from Rome to Isfahan.
